Château de Jau 2002 Grenache Blanc (Grand Roussillon)

  1. $26
Made entirely from Grenache Blanc and fortified to 16% alcohol, this is an intriguing dessert wine. After aging in barrel for three years, it’s taken on some nutty overtones, yet still retains a perfumed quality and orange-citrus flavors. Probably best with cheeses or on its own.  — J.C.  (12/15/2007)

Château de Jau 2008 Red (Côtes du Roussillon Villages)

  • Online Exclusive
  1. $16
Lean red fruit and sweet spice aromas lead the way on the bouquet of this blend, made from 45% Syrah, 30% Mourvèdre, 10% Grenache and 15% Carignan. The palate offers more of the same, with a lean structure and a surpringly sweet finish.  — L.B.  (2/1/2012)
